How they compare

Israel currently reports 0.0459 kt against 0.0363 kt in Libya, a difference of 0.0096 kt.

That makes Israel's figure about 1.3 times Libya's.

The two have swapped places 22 times across 65 shared years of data; in 1961 it was Israel ahead.

Israel ranks 82nd and Libya ranks 84th of 125 countries.

Across the 9 decades both report, Israel averaged higher in 6 and Libya in 3.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
